KOtBu (2.81 g, 25.08 mmol) was dissolved into 20 ml DMSO in a round bottom flask. tert-butyl 4-(4-aminobenzoyl)piperazine-1-carboxylate (7 g, 22.92 mmol) in 30 ml DMSO was added and the resulting mixture was stirred for 15 minutes at room temperature, then cooled in an iced bath for 5 minutes. 5-bromo-2-fluorobenzonitrile (4.6 g, 23.00 mmol) in 20 ml DMSO was added. The ice bath was removed and the mixture stirred for 5 hours while warming to room temperature. LCMS showed product and unreacted starting materials. Additional KOtBu (2 g, 17.82 mmol) was added and the reaction stirred at room temperature overnight. The mixture was transferred into a separating funnel that was loaded with dichloromethane and dilute aq. NH4Cl solution. The layers were separated, the organic layer washed one more time with water, then brine, dried over Mg504, filtered and concentrated in vacuum. The crude was dissolved in dichloromethane, and refluxed while adding ethyl acetate until the solution becomes cloudy, then allowed to stand and cool to room temperature. The product precipitated and was collected by filtration. 6.40 g tert-butyl 4-(4-(4-bromo-2-cyanophenylamino)-benzoyl)piperazine-1-carboxylate were isolated as a white solid. The mother liquor was concentrated in vacuum and purified by column chromatography on silica, gradient from 100% dichloromethane to 50% ethyl acetate in dichloromethane. Product containing fractions were combined and evaporate to give additional 0.90 g product as a pale yellow solid. MS (ESI) m/z 485/487 (1 Br isotope pattern) (M+H), 429/431 (1 Br isotope pattern) (M+H—C4H8). 1H NMR (CDCl3) δ ppm 7.64 (s, 1H), 7.50 (d, 1H, J=9.2), 7.42 (d, 2H, J=8.3), 7.19-7.15 (m, 3H), 6.39 (s, 1H), 3.80-3.40 (b, 8H), 1.47 (s, 9H).
